Porch repair services involve fixing and restoring the structural elements of a porch to ensure safety, stability, and visual appeal. This can include replacing rotted or damaged wood, repairing or installing new railings, steps, and flooring, as well as addressing issues with support beams and posts. Skilled contractors assess the condition of the existing porch and perform necessary repairs to prevent further deterioration, helping to maintain the home's exterior and provide a welcoming entryway.
These services are essential for solving common problems such as wood rot, insect damage, loose or broken railings, cracked or uneven steps, and sagging or weakened supports. Over time, exposure to weather elements can cause wood to decay or warp, leading to safety hazards and aesthetic concerns. Local contractors can evaluate the extent of damage and recommend repairs that restore the porch’s integrity, ensuring it remains safe for everyday use and enhances the property's overall appearance.

The overview below groups typical Porch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most routine porch repair projects typically cost between $250 and $600. These jobs often involve fixing minor damage or replacing small sections of the porch. Many local contractors handle these common repairs within this range.
Moderate Renovations - Mid-sized porch upgrades, such as replacing railings or resurfacing, generally fall between $600 and $2,000. These projects are common and can vary depending on materials and scope, with larger, more detailed work reaching higher costs.
Full Porch Replacement - Replacing an entire porch can range from $3,000 to $8,000 or more, depending on size, materials, and design complexity. Many projects in this category are substantial but fall within this typical range, while more intricate builds can push costs higher.
Custom or Large-Scale Projects - Extensive porch rebuilds or custom-designed structures can exceed $10,000, with larger, more complex projects reaching $20,000 or beyond. Such projects are less common and usually involve premium materials and detailed craftsmanship.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Clear, written expectations are essential when selecting a porch repair professional. A reputable service provider should be able to provide detailed descriptions of the scope of work, materials to be used, and the steps involved in completing the project.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ures that both parties are aligned on what will be delivered. It also offers an opportunity to compare different contractors based on the thoroughness and clarity of their proposals.

What types of porch repair services are available? Local contractors offer a range of services including porch surface repairs, railing replacements, step repairs, and structural assessments to restore safety and appearance.
How do I know if my porch needs repairs? Signs such as rotting wood, loose railings, cracks, or uneven surfaces can indicate the need for professional inspection and repair by local service providers.
Can porch repairs improve safety? Yes, addressing issues like loose or damaged steps, unstable railings, and rotting wood can enhance the safety of a porch area.
What materials are commonly used for porch repairs? Common materials include pressure-treated wood, composite decking, vinyl railings, and concrete, depending on the repair type and existing porch structure.
